Ingredients
For the Pasta
- 200 g fettuccine or tagliatelle
- 1 tsp salt (for boiling water)
For the Chicken
- 250 g chicken breast, sliced into strips
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- Salt & pepper to taste
For the Alfredo Sauce
- 2 tbsp butter
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 200 ml heavy cream
- 60 g Parmesan cheese, grated
- 1 cup broccoli florets, lightly steamed
- Fresh parsley, chopped
- Salt & pepper
How to Make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Boil water in a large pot. Add salt once it’s boiling. Cook the fettuccine or tagliatelle until al dente according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
Step 2: Prepare the Chicken
In a skillet over medium heat, add olive oil. Season sliced chicken breast with salt and pepper. Grill until golden brown and cooked through, about 5–7 minutes. Remove from heat and set aside.
Step 3: Make the Alfredo Sauce
In the same skillet where you cooked the chicken, melt butter over low heat. Add min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ant. Pour in heavy cream and let it simmer gently while stirring occasionally.
Step 4: Combine Ingredients
Stir in grated Parmesan cheese into the sauce until it thickens. Add steamed broccoli florets and cooked pasta into the skillet. Toss everything together until evenly coated with sauce.
Step 5: Serve
Plate your delicious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li. Top each serving with sliced chicken breast and a sprinkle of freshly chopped parsley for garnish. Enjoy!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li, several common mistakes can impact the dish’s flavor and texture. Here are a few to keep in mind.
-
Overcooking the Pasta: Cooking pasta for too long can result in a mushy texture. Always aim for al dente, which means it should have a slight bite. Remember to drain it promptly once cooked.
-
Skipping the Seasoning: Failing to season your chicken or sauce can lead to bland results. Season each component individually with salt and pepper to enhance overall flavor.
-
Not Using Fresh Ingredients: Relying on stale ingredients can diminish taste. Use fresh garlic and quality cheese for the best flavor in your Alfredo sauce.
-
Adding Broccoli Too Early: If you add broccoli too soon, it may become overcooked and lose its vibrant color and crunch. Lightly steam it just before adding to the pasta.
-
Ignoring Sauce Thickness: A good Alfredo sauce should have a creamy consistency. If it’s too thin, let it simmer longer, allowing it to thicken before mixing in the pasta.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ftovers in an airtight container.
- Consume within 3-4 days for optimal freshness.
Freezing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li
- Freeze in a freezer-safe container, leaving space for expansion.
- Best used within 2-3 months for best flavor and texture.
Reheating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li
-
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C). Place in an oven-safe dish, cover with foil, and heat until warmed through.
-
Microwave: Use a microwave-safe bowl, cover lightly, and heat in short bursts (1-2 minutes), stirring between intervals.
-
Stovetop: Heat gently over low heat while stirring frequently. Add a splash of cream if needed for moisture.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about preparing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li.
Can I use different types of pasta?
Yes! While fettuccine or tagliatelle is traditional, you can substitute with penne or spaghetti based on your preference.
How do I make the sauce lighter?
For a lighter version of Creamy Chicken Alfredo with Broccoli, consider replacing heavy cream with half-and-half or using less butter.
Can I add other vegetables?
Absolutely! Feel free to include vegetables like spinach or bell peppers to enhance nutrition and flavor.
What can I substitute for Parmesan cheese?
If you’re looking for alternatives, try nutritional yeast or any grated hard cheese that melts well as a substitute for Parmesan cheese.
